What are the factors that determine the acceleration time (in sec. ) from 0 to 60 miles per hour of a car? Data on the following variables for 171 different vehicle models were collected:
Accel Time: Acceleration time in sec.
Cargo Vol: Cargo volume in cu.ft.
HP: Horsepower MPG: Miles per gallon
SUV: 1 if the vehicle model is an SUV with Coupe as the base when SUV and Sedan are both 0 Sedan: 1 if the vehicle model is a sedan with Coupe as the base when SUV and Sedan are both 0
The regression results using acceleration time as the dependent variable and the remaining variables as the independent variables are presented below.

Moral Imagination

The ability to ethically envision the full range of possible actions in a particular situation.

Diversity

The inclusion of individuals from a variety of backgrounds, perspectives, and abilities, contributing to a rich, dynamic, and innovative environment.

Time Orientation

An individual's or culture's approach to time, focusing on the past, present, or future, and influencing priorities, planning, and punctuality.

Rationality

The quality of being based on or in accordance with reason or logic.
